MEDS-072 covers a wide range of topics including: foundational population theories (e.g., Malthusian, demographic transition), concepts of fertility, mortality, and migration, analysis of national and international population policies, the structure and impact of family health and reproductive health programmes, and the interlinkages between population dynamics, environment, and sustainable development.
